What is a moisturizing lotion?
A moisturizing lotion or cream is a skincare product that is designed to hydrate and nourish the skin. It is usually applied after cleansing and toning the skin. The primary function of a moisturizing lotion is to lock in moisture and prevent the skin from drying out. It also helps to restore the skin's natural barrier, which can be damaged by environmental factors such as pollution and UV radiation. Some of the common ingredients found in moisturizing lotions include hyaluronic acid, glycerin, and ceramides.
The benefits of using a moisturizing lotion
1. Keeps the skin hydrated: One of the most significant benefits of using a moisturizing lotion is that it keeps the skin hydrated. When the skin is dehydrated, it can become dry, flaky, and itchy. Using a moisturizing lotion regularly can prevent these issues and keep the skin looking healthy and radiant. 2. Prevents signs of aging: Dry skin is more prone to wrinkles and fine lines. By keeping the skin hydrated, a moisturizing lotion can help prevent premature aging and keep the skin looking youthful. 3. Soothes sensitive skin: If you have sensitive skin, using a moisturizing lotion can help soothe and calm any irritation or redness. It can also help to strengthen the skin's barrier, making it less susceptible to environmental irritants. 4. Improves skin texture: A moisturizing lotion can help to improve the texture of the skin, making it smoother and more supple. It can also help to reduce the appearance of pores and fine lines. 5. Enhances the effectiveness of other skincare products: Using a moisturizing lotion can help to enhance the effectiveness of other skincare products. When the skin is properly hydrated, it is more receptive to other active ingredients, such as antioxidants and retinoids.
